Obtaining an NVQ Level 3 in Health and Social Care can be a valuable investment in your career. However, it's essential to consider the costs associated with pursuing this qualification.
| Item | Cost |
|---|---|
| Tuition Fees | $1000 - $3000 |
| Study Materials | $200 - $500 |
| Assessment Fees | $300 - $600 |
It's important to budget for tuition fees, study materials, and assessment fees when pursuing an NVQ Level 3 in Health and Social Care. These costs can vary depending on the training provider and location.
Tuition fees cover the cost of the training program and can range from $1000 to $3000. Be sure to research different training providers to find the best value for your investment.
Study materials such as textbooks and online resources are essential for completing the NVQ Level 3. Budget around $200 to $500 for these materials to ensure you have everything you need to succeed.
Assessment fees cover the cost of evaluating your performance throughout the qualification. These fees typically range from $300 to $600 and are crucial for achieving your NVQ Level 3.
